STATESBORO, Ga. – Georgia Southern's MiMi DuBose and Anna Claire Knight have been named Preseason All-Southern Conference by College Sports Madness. DuBose earned a spot on the first team, while Knight was named to the second team.
DuBose averaged 12.4 points a game last season and was the only Eagle to start all 31 contests. The senior recorded double figures in the scoring column in 19 outings, scored 20 or more points seven times and led the Eagles in scoring 16 times. She ranked fourth in the league in 3-pointers made (1.8/gm) and 10th in the conference in free-throw percentage (.802).
Knight averaged 11.7 points and 5.9 rebounds a game for the Eagles in 2012-13. The junior was fifth in the league in free-throw percentage (.853) and 3-point percentage (.326). She scored in double figures 19 times, netted 20-plus points in three games and recorded two double-doubles.
Georgia Southern returns four starters and nine letterwinners, including four of its top-five scorers from last season. The Eagles open the season at Auburn Nov. 9, and play their home opener against Jacksonville State Nov. 16 at 5:30 p.m., in a tripleheader with the Eagle volleyball and men's basketball teams.
